Improving Business Performance through Human Resources Development

Six Sigma Certificate Training Six Sigma has become the world standard for improving all types of product and service operations. It is a systems approach to improving organizational performance.

Methodology:The Six Sigma strategy involves a series of steps that are specifically designed to lead the organi-zation through process improvements.

DMAIIC1. DEFINE. Identify critical process characteris-tics.

2. MEASURE. Document the existing process, perform necessary measurements, and estimate the process capability.

3. ANALYZE. Analyze performance measures to determine the amount of improvement that is possible to make the critical quality characteris-

tics and requirements “best in class.” This may involve process redesign.

4. IMPROVE. Identify specific product charac-teristics that must be improved to achieve the performance and financial goals. Once this is done, the characteristics are diagnosed to reveal the major sources of variation through statisti-cally designed experiments.

5. IMPLEMENT. Execute the improvement plans; overcome barriers. Transition to the new process.

6. CONTROL. Measure improvements and breakthroughs. Report scorecard data and client feedback. Continually monitor.

Green Belt CertificateThree-day workshop. Participants gain an over-view on the critical success factors of Six Sigma implementation.

GREEN BELT PROGRAM AGENDA• Six Sigma Objectives and Philosophy • Seven Basic Quality Tools • Theory of Variation • Statistics/ SPC • Process Capability• Cost Implications• Root Cause Analysis • Case Study• GB Certificate Exam

Black Belt CertificateThree-week intensive training program. Em-phasis is on in-depth applications of statistical concepts and methodologies. This curriculum is based on the ASQ BB exam competencies for the national Black Belt certification.Prequisites: Green Belt Certification and successful completion of an Intro to Statis-tics course or passing level on an exemption pre-test.Note: For Black Belt certification, participants must attend all sessions, pass the BB exam, and complete an acceptable project no later than one year from start date of BB-1 training.
